CMOP Distinguished Lecture Series

CMOP Distinguished Lecture Series brings leading scientists and researchers from around the country to the center. Lecturers present an hour long talk, meet with students and researchers, and participate in focus groups.

The lecture is held on the OHSU West Campus in the Paul Clayton Building—Room PC401. The lecture is open to the public.
